What is SYMS?

TheSociety of Young Mathematicians is for all young people who enjoymathematics, whether they are in a junior or secondary school. Membersare part of a national organisation which motivates and encouragesyoung mathematicians.

SYMS Membership

Fullmembership is open to all young mathematicians and runs from 1stSeptember to the following 31st August. Members receive all 3 issues ofthe journals, whatever time of year they join. Membership is £9.99 peryear (£13.99 if outside the UK in Europe, £17.99 for airmail outside Europe).

Journals

Everyterm members receive the SYMS Newsletter – SymmetryPlus, which containsshort articles, news, things to do, calculator hints, book reviews,games, puzzles and competitions. Members also receive termly copies ofthe journal Mathematical Pie. Again, Mathematical Pie containsinteresting maths problems, puzzles and articles. SYMS encourages andsupports mathematical activities for young mathematicians of all ages.Adults are very welcome to join SYMS.

SYMS members will receive Symmetry Plus and Mathematical Pie delivered direct to their homes.
